Instructions
1
Bring broth to a boil in a small saucepan. Off heat, add sun-dried tomatoes and soak until softened, about 15 minutes. Drain; reserve broth. Coarsely chop sun-dried tomatoes; set aside.
2
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Add penne and cook, stirring occasionally, until tender yet firm to the bite, 9 to 12 minutes. Drain.
3
Cook and stir pine nuts in a skillet over medium heat until lightly toasted. Transfer to a bowl; set aside.
4
Heat olive oil and pepper flakes in the same skillet over medium heat; add garlic and cook until tender, about 1 minute. Add spinach; cook until almost wilted. Add reserved broth and sun-dried tomatoes; cook and stir until heated through, about 2 minutes.
5
Toss penne, spinach mixture, and pine nuts together in a large bowl. Serve with Parmesan cheese.
